Microsoft Kinect in Gesture Recognition: A Short Review

Microsoft Kinect sensor is a low cost, high-resolution, depth and visual (RGB) sensing device. It became popular in a very short span for widespread use. The depth and visual information (RGB-D) together provided by the Kinect sensor opens up new opportunities for computer vision. This paper contains an overview of evolution of different versions of Kinect and highlights the differences of their key features. It also reviews the use of Kinect v1 and v2 in gesture recognition, an important field of computer vision. Finally, a summary of the challenges in this field and future research trends is provided.
